Invalid argument: 'r"D:\\Desktop\\car"1.log'
时间: 2023-11-17 14:04:15 浏览: 27
这个错误通常是由于文件路径中包含非法字符或格式不正确导致的。在这个例子中,文件路径中似乎有一个多余的引号,导致路径格式不正确。解决这个问题的方法是删除多余的引号或者使用正确的文件路径格式。
以下是一个演示如何使用正确的文件路径格式的例子:
```python
import os
# 使用os.path.join()函数来连接文件路径
file_path = os.path.join("D:", "Desktop", "car1.log")
# 打开文件
with open(file_path, "r") as f:
# 处理文件
pass
```
相关问题
python导入excel数据出现 Invalid argument: '"D:\\Desktop\\data.xlsx"
这个错误通常是由于文件路径中的反斜杠`\`被转义所导致的。在 Python 中,反斜杠`\`被用作转义字符,因此如果你在字符串中使用反斜杠,Python 可能会将其解释为特殊字符,而不是路径分隔符。
为了解决这个问题,你可以使用以下两种方法之一:
1. 将反斜杠`\`替换为正斜杠`/`,例如:
```python
df = pd.read_excel('D:/Desktop/data.xlsx')
```
2. 在字符串前加上字母`r`,表示原始字符串,例如:
```python
df = pd.read_excel(r'D:\Desktop\data.xlsx')
```
这样 Python 就不会将反斜杠`\`解释为特殊字符了。如果你还是遇到问题,可以尝试将整个路径用双引号`"`括起来,例如:
```python
df = pd.read_excel('"D:/Desktop/data.xlsx"')
```
这样做可以防止 Python 将路径中的空格解释为分隔符。
Invalid argument: 'F:\x0biew.bmp'
看起来你遇到了一个参数错误。这可能是由于你传递给函数的参数格式不正确而导致的。请检查你传递给函数的参数是否正确。
此外,如果你使用了转义字符,请确保它们被正确处理。例如,如果你在Windows系统上使用反斜杠`\`来表示文件路径,则需要将其转义为`\\`,或者使用原始字符串`r`来表示路径,例如`r'F:\x0biew.bmp'`。
如果你仍然无法解决问题,请提供更多的上下文和代码,以便我可以更好地帮助你。